Trends in State Policies That Support the Community Health Worker Workforce

by

Authors: Megan D’Alessandro, Elinor Higgins, Sandra Wilkniss

States are working to sustain and expand the community health worker (CHW) workforce as federal COVID-19 funding ends. Many are exploring long-term financing solutions, particularly through Medicaid, to ensure continued access to CHW services. Policymakers are collaborating with CHWs and stakeholders to strengthen training, certification, and funding strategies. This NASHP’s updated 50-state tracker highlights these efforts, offering insights into state approaches to Medicaid reimbursement, workforce development, and policy advancements supporting CHWs.
